Understanding Hotel Pricing

Before we dive into the topic, it’s important to understand how hotel pricing works. Hotels typically set their rates based on various factors such as demand, seasonality, and competition in the area. They also take into account any promotions or discounts they may be offering.

The Role of Online Travel Agencies

In recent years, online travel agencies (OTAs) have become the go-to option for many travelers. These platforms offer a wide range of hotels and often provide competitive rates. However, hotels have to pay a commission to these agencies for each booking made through their platform.

Direct Bookings and Incentives

Hotels are always looking for ways to encourage travelers to book directly with them instead of through OTAs. As a result, they may offer special incentives for direct bookings, such as free upgrades, complimentary breakfast, or even discounts.

Calling a Hotel for a Discount

Now, let’s address the main question: Can you call a hotel and ask for a discount? The answer is, it depends. While hotels have the flexibility to offer discounts, it’s not guaranteed that they will grant your request. However, it doesn’t hurt to try!

Timing is Key

If you’re going to call a hotel and ask for a discount, timing is crucial. Avoid calling during peak times when the hotel is likely to be busy. Instead, try calling during off-peak hours when the staff has more time to entertain your request.

Politeness and Negotiation

When you call a hotel, it’s important to be polite and respectful. Remember that the person on the other end of the line is just doing their job. Explain your situation and politely ask if there are any available discounts or promotions that you could take advantage of.

Alternatives to Phone Calls

While calling a hotel is one way to inquire about discounts, there are other alternatives you can consider:

Online Chat

Many hotels now offer online chat support on their websites. This can be a convenient way to communicate with the hotel staff and inquire about any available discounts.

Email Inquiries

Sending an email to the hotel’s reservation team is another option. Be sure to clearly state your request and provide relevant information such as your travel dates and the number of people in your party.
